Battleford proposes 3.9 per cent tax increase for 2026 budget
The capital and operational budget was proposed to the town of Battleford’s council.
Chief financial officer Tetiana Polishchuk presented the 2026 budget with a proposed 3.9 per cent tax increase, which will amount to a $143 annual increase per household.
The town mayor said he has mixed emotions about the numbers but said ultimately, at some point, council must address the infrastructure deficit.
“As a council, you’re responsible to make sure that the taxpayers and residents can bear increases,” said Ames Leslie. “Presently, we’re in a state of economy where every increase hits residents and people of this community and this province and this country significantly more than it normally would.”
